What Is Blue Light and Why Does It Matter?
Blue light is a high-energy visible light emitted by digital screens. While it’s naturally present in sunlight, excessive exposure from devices can cause:
- Eye strain and fatigue.
- Headaches and disrupted sleep patterns.
- Potential long-term damage to retinal cells.
Benefits of Blue Light Glasses
- Reduced Eye Strain: Special coatings on the lenses filter out harmful blue light, allowing your eyes to relax during screen time.
- Improved Sleep: By blocking blue light, these glasses help regulate your body’s natural sleep-wake cycle, ensuring restful sleep.
- Enhanced Productivity: Comfortable eyes mean better focus and efficiency, whether at work or play.
